What is a machine learning unpaid internship?

A Machine Learning Unpaid Internship is a temporary position where students or recent graduates work with professionals to gain practical experience in machine learning without receiving monetary compensation. Interns typically assist with data analysis, model development, and research tasks, while learning about real-world machine learning applications. These internships help individuals build relevant skills, expand their professional network, and improve their resumes for future job opportunities.

What kinds of projects and responsibilities can I expect during a machine learning unpaid internship?

As a machine learning unpaid intern, you will typically work on projects such as data preprocessing, model training, and performance evaluation under the guidance of experienced team members. Your daily tasks may include cleaning datasets, implementing algorithms, and conducting experiments to test model improvements. Interns often collaborate with data scientists and engineers, participating in team meetings and code reviews to learn best practices. This hands-on experience provides valuable exposure to real-world machine learning workflows and tools, helping you build skills that are essential for future roles in the field.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a machine learning unpaid int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Machine Learning Unpaid Intern, you should have a solid understanding of linear algebra, statistics, and programming languages like Python, along with coursework or experience in machine learning concepts. Familiarity with tools such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, scikit-learn, and version control systems like Git is typically expected. Strong problem-solving skills, eagerness to learn, and effective communication set standout interns apart. These skills are essential for contributing to projects, adapting quickly in a dynamic field, and collaborating with team members on real-world machine learning challenges.

What is the difference between Machine Learning Unpaid Internship vs Data Science Intern?

AspectMachine Learning Unpaid InternshipData Science Intern
Required CredentialsBasic programming, coursework in ML or AIStatistics, programming, data analysis skills
Work EnvironmentStartups, tech companies, research labsTech firms, consulting agencies, research institutions
Industry UsageFocus on ML model development and algorithmsBroader data analysis, visualization, reporting

The main difference is that a Machine Learning Unpaid Internship emphasizes developing ML models and algorithms, often requiring knowledge of programming and AI concepts. In contrast, a Data Science Intern role covers a wider range of data analysis tasks, including visualization and reporting. Both roles are common in tech and research environments, but the internship focus and skill requirements differ slightly.
